Sliding Door Won't Slide

There's a difference between a door that's merely hard to open and one that barely moves at all, even with real effort. If yours feels almost frozen in place, here's what's usually going on.

Most Common Causes

Stiff vs. Seized

If the door moves an inch or two with real force, the rollers are likely just dried out and need lubrication or replacement. If it doesn't budge at all, something is physically jamming it, and forcing it harder risks damaging the frame or glass.

What Not to Do

Don't keep pushing harder or use tools to pry it, this risks cracking the glass or damaging the frame around the track.

Why Forcing It Makes Things Worse

Continued force on a nearly-seized door can snap a roller axle or bend the track, turning an hour-long fix into a multi-day repair.

Why This Happens More in Florida

Humidity swelling combined with dried-out, corroded rollers is a common one-two punch in Florida homes.

Is this different from a door that's just heavy?

Yes, a heavy door still moves with effort. A door that won't slide at all usually has something specific jamming it.

Can I identify the jam myself?

Check the track for visible debris first. If nothing is visible, the jam point is likely hidden and needs inspection.
